July 14, 1999 Zanesville, Ohio
Session III
Treadway Gallery American European Art Pottery Sales leader
Lots 1409-1421

1409.Owens vessels, attribution, two, both marked Hobo, tallest 6"h, minor flaws 200-300

1410.Nice RV Rozane Aztec vase, Arts & Crafts design in squeezebag technique, impressed number, 8.5"h, firing bubbles, mint 300-500

1411. RV candlestick, 4"h, mint 100-150

1412. RV Sunflower vase, paper label, 6"h, mint

550-750

1413. Unusual Weller Rhead vase, attribution, stylized landscape with finely carved trees and flowers, 12.5"h, restoration to top 500-700

1414.RV Futura vase, floral design, 5.5"w, minute flake 300-400

1415. Weller Souveo hanging basket, Native American design, unusual item, 9"h, minor line 250-350

1416.Vance Avon vase, large example with embossed mermaids, shell fish and other fish, impressed mark, 12"h, chips to foot and lip 500-700

1417. RV Futura hanging basket, 7.5"w, minor flake 250-350

1418.Weller Dickensware vase, incised and painted cavalier, impressed mark, artist intialed, 13.5"h, mint 500-700

1419.Good RV Monticello vase, 7.5"w, mint 350-450

1420.RV candlesticks, pair, 5"w, mint 100-200

1421. Red Wing vase, molded design of trees in four panels, stamp mark, 9.5"h, mint 150-250
